A plume of smoke rises from an oil tanker "Golden Lucy" after an explosion in Port Harcourt, Nigeria, January 11, 2008. Militants fighting for autonomy in Nigeria's oil-producing south detonated a remote controlled bomb on an oil tanker, causing a large fire. It was the second rebel attack on Africa's largest oil industry in a week, but exports of crude oil were unaffected, industry sources said. REUTERS/Handout (NIGERIA). EDITORIAL USE ONLY.
